What California Employers Look For

The qualifications that appear most often in shift lead jobs across California.

  • At least one to three years of frontline or team-based work experience in the relevant industry
  • Demonstrated ability to supervise a team, delegate tasks, and hold staff accountable during a shift
  • Familiarity with California meal and rest break compliance requirements under state labor law
  • Food Handler Card or California Food Manager Certification for shift leads in food service settings
  • Proficiency with scheduling software, point-of-sale systems, or warehouse management platforms
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ills for reporting to store, facility, or operations managers

How do you become a shift lead in California?

Most shift lead roles in California are filled by promoting experienced frontline workers who demonstrate reliability and team leadership, with no state-issued license required for the majority of industries. Food service leads working in establishments that serve certain food types must hold a California Food Handler Card or a Food Safety Manager Certification accredited by the American National Standards Institute. Beyond certification, California employers typically expect candidates to have completed relevant on-the-job training or an internal leadership development program before stepping into a shift lead role.

How can I get hired as a shift lead in California with little or no experience?

The most realistic entry path is landing a frontline role first and pursuing an internal promotion, since California employers like Amazon, Target, and Kaiser Permanente regularly run structured leadership development programs that move strong associates into shift lead positions within months. Adjacent roles like team member, key holder, lead associate, or department specialist are the common springboards. Earning a California Food Handler Card, a forklift certification, or completing a retail management certificate through a California community college can strengthen an application when direct experience is limited.
